Braintree

MP: Sir James Cleverly (Conservative) England Data to July 2026

Braintree has 51 MW of clean power (all solar) approved and still not built: enough to supply a year's electricity to 18,000 homes. Britain's grid bottlenecks still add to bills here: about £92 a year per household, £4.0m across the constituency's 43,166 homes.

Ranks 133 of 650 for clean power approved and not built.
